Danger Reduction in Estate Management
Just how can probate bonds help you reduce threats in estate management?
Probate bonds function as an important tool in guarding the passions of the estate and its recipients. By needing the administrator or administrator to obtain a probate bond, the court ensures that the private managing the estate acts according to the legislation and fulfills their tasks responsibly.
In the unfortunate event of mismanagement or misconduct, the probate bond provides a financial safeguard. If the administrator breaches their fiduciary tasks, resulting in monetary losses to the estate or beneficiaries, the bond can be used to compensate for these problems. This security uses assurance to the beneficiaries, recognizing that there's a recourse offered in case of any type of messing up of estate properties.
In addition, probate bonds assist deter potential transgression, as the executor knows the effects of their actions. As a result, by needing a probate bond, you can proactively alleviate dangers and ensure the correct management of the estate.

Legal Compliance and Peace of Mind
Ensuring legal compliance with probate bond demands offers peace of mind for recipients and safeguards their passions in estate planning. By needing the administrator or manager of an estate to acquire a probate bond, the legal system guarantees that the specific handling the estate's events is held accountable for their activities. This liability offers a layer of security for beneficiaries, guaranteeing them that the estate will be managed sensibly and ethically.
Probate bonds additionally act as a legal secure in case the administrator falls short to meet their obligations appropriately. In such instances, recipients have the right to sue versus the bond to look for compensation for any type of financial losses incurred due to the administrator's misconduct or oversight. This legal option supplies beneficiaries a sense of security, knowing that there are actions in place to address any type of possible messing up of the estate.
Eventually, by adhering to probate bond needs, recipients can feel confident that their passions are secured, and estate preparation is carried out in a clear and legal fashion.
